## Deployment — GateTally

GateTally, the stadium turnstile counter service, deploys as a single container per venue gateway. Before promoting a release, verify that the local count buffer is flushed and the aggregation endpoint is reachable, since unflushed tallies are discarded on restart. Releases must roll out gate-by-gate, never venue-wide at once. The deployed service reads the following configuration values at startup.

settings of tagef-bawif:
DRUIX_HOST=druix.zemvarlabs.internal
DRUIX_PORT=8000

# Break-Glass: Catalog Cache Invalidation

Scope: the Pinrow product catalog at Veldstone Retail. If stale prices persist after a purge and the Hollowmere invalidation queue is wedged, use break-glass to flush the edge tier directly. Contractors: get verbal sign-off from the catalog lead first. Steps: open the Hollowmere admin shell, select emergency-flush, confirm the tenant, and run it once — repeated flushes thrash the origin. Access is logged and expires after 20 minutes. Unseal the admin shell with the passphrase below.

recovery phrase for kahop-tajog: istix-casvan

## Runbook: Report Export TZ

All exports in Lanternfell run in UTC internally. The scheduler converts to the customer's locale at render time only. Never patch timestamps in the export queue; fix the locale table instead. If a customer reports shifted rows, check the `tz_overrides` table before anything else. DST bugs almost always trace back to stale override entries. To inspect overrides directly, connect to the reporting replica using the string below.

primary connection of yagep-kahip = redis://giliel_svc:zYiKsLL2PLpfPL@db-348f.xolmarsys.corp:5432/fenwyn

## TICKET-4412: Signature check fails after rounding fix

Hey folks — after we patched the half-even rounding in the Lumenpay currency converter plugin, the registry started rejecting our uploads with "signature mismatch." Turns out the build step rewrites the rates fixture (the rounding change touches it), so the archive hash no longer matches what was signed. Fix: sign after the fixture regen, not before. If you're re-signing an affected build, use the current publisher key, which is:

rollout seal: bky4_x7Gc